Veryl G. Johnson, 83, a resident of 712 9th Ave., Charles City, died Tuesday morning, Feb. 15, 2000, at the Ninth Street Chautauqua Guest Home.
Funeral services were held at 10:30 a.m. on Thursday, Feb. 17, at the Trinity United Methodist Church in Charles City. The Rev. Dianne Christopher, senior pastor, officiated. Burial was at 1:30 p.m. in the Alcock Cemetery in rural Fredrika.
Veryl Glen Johnson was born June 19, 1916 in Chickasaw County, the son of John and Clara (Pike) Johson. He received his education in the rural Chickasaw County schools and on Sept. 21, 1939, he and Jean Arminta Cheever were married at Waverly. He farmed, worked at the Oliver Corp., and was an animal caretaker for the Salsbury Laboratories for 20 years.
He was a member of the Trinity United Methodist Church, the Moose Lodge, the Royal Neighbors at Bassett, and was a part of the Civilian Conservation Corps. He loved farming, fishing, and helping people.
Living family members include his wife, Jean of Charles City; a son, Steve and his wife, Kathie Johnson of Houston, Texas; two daughters and their husbands, Veryla and Charley Brewer of Bella Vista, AR, and Sharon and Jim Zenor of Ames; six grandchildren: Don and Mark DeWalle, Chad and Kelly Johnson, Mike Zenor, and Jackie Lund; three step great-grandchildren: Wes, Gabe, and Jay Jimenez; two brothers, Everett Johnson of Waterloo and Laurence Johnson of Janesville; and a sister, Patricia Zubak of Cedar Falls.
He was preceded in death by his parents and a sister, Audrey in her youth.

(The Charles City Press" 2-17-2000)
